"A really beautiful place! In the middle of some hotels and on the top of a small hill are the ruins of an old monastery church dedicated to Bernardino of Siena, a saint who lived in the 14. and 15.century. The church was also built in the 15. century and the monastery was abolished in the early 19.century. The buildings were later used also as a fort. The ruins are renovated and very well taken care for. A nice place for taking pictures and also to see some nice stone decorations. Nearby there is a lookout on the surroundings with great views. I recommend a visit!"

A Glimpse into History

The St. Bernardin Church Ruins are remnants of a significant 15th-century monastery church dedicated to Bernardino of Siena. The monastery itself was active until the early 19th century, after which the buildings were repurposed, even serving as a fort at one point. The ruins have since been renovated and are meticulously maintained, offering a tangible connection to the area's past. Visitors can appreciate the historical layers, from its religious origins to its later military use. Reddit

The renovation efforts have ensured that the ruins are not only preserved but also presented in a way that highlights their architectural beauty and historical importance. The stone decorations within the ruins are particularly noteworthy, showcasing the craftsmanship of the era. This blend of history and preservation makes it a compelling site for those interested in local heritage. Reddit
